Look for a detailed breakdown based on the type of work. Remodel quotes should include framing, decking material, railings, stairs, and any added features like lighting or built-in seating. Repair estimates should cover board replacement, fasteners, hardware, and structural work. For staining or sealing, check for cleaning, prep, number of coats, and the type of product used. Make sure the quote also includes a timeline, warranty, and permit requirements if needed.

Decks are constantly exposed to sun, rain, and foot traffic. Over time, this leads to fading, warping, and general wear. Investing in repairs or refinishing prevents further damage and extends the life of your deck. A remodel adds space and improves layout, while staining and sealing enhance both appearance and protection. These upgrades increase the value of your home and improve how you use your yard.
Basic cleaning or spot staining may be possible to handle yourself. Larger repairs, full resurfacing, or new builds require more experience and tools than most homeowners have. Professional contractors follow building codes, ensure structural safety, and deliver cleaner finishes that last longer and require fewer touch-ups.
